The Best Awards: FIFA Names Ousmane Dembélé Player of the Year

After winning the Ballon d’Or in 2025, Paris Saint-Germain striker Ousmane Dembélé has also been awarded the FIFA The Best Player of the Year title in Doha this Tuesday. The former Rennes player outpaced Kylian Mbappé and Lamine Yamal.

Last season, Dembélé scored 35 goals and provided 16 assists. He played a crucial role in PSG’s victory in the Champions League, making him the clear favorite for this award. Despite facing challenges in recent months due to injuries and absences, his progress has been acknowledged by experts across the board.

In addition to his trademark dribbling, the former Barça and Rennes player has developed a significant finishing ability. Previously criticized for his clumsiness in front of goal, he has found his effectiveness under the guidance of coach Luis Enrique, who repositioned him in a more central role.

I want to thank all my teammates. Hard work pays off. I thank my family, the PSG club with which we’ve had a fantastic year. Thank you to Gianni Infantino, I received your message on my birthday. I hope to come back once again next year,” Dembélé stated during the event.
